Output 584cb4e62e43c7a3d4d5dcbfa55e8444bc2d6a16a9c54599ac852ed4129fdfc0:0

value
1892847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a55e113b00d1e4bd4c691fb7247dec0df3122c OP_EQUAL
address
3DsftzKYKRwctYMGXe2yHPRUAXzytTSvez
transaction
584cb4e62e43c7a3d4d5dcbfa55e8444bc2d6a16a9c54599ac852ed4129fdfc0
spent
true